Commission I: Territorial Goals and Strategies for Reconstruction, overall study of the territory of Haiti.
Commission II: Structuring model for the territory around the Boucle Centre - Artibonite

After an initial “Haiti Tomorrow” project consisting of an overall study throughout the territory (Commission I), Boucle Centre-Artibonite (Commission II) projects in time a space designed as an organic whole, built around a road structure designed to structure a territory in depth.
Meetings with the affected populations and discussions with political authorities and civil society made it possible to correct choices made by technicians and integrate the ideas and wishes of the population into the design.
The Boucle Centre-Artibonite project is a concrete project for territorial development designed to include an economic project. It is a model for structuring the territory of Haiti.
